About Brian Prest

Brian Prest is a scholar working on Renewable Energy, Sustainability and the Environment, Economics and Econometrics, General Decision Sciences, General Economics, Econometrics and Finance and Global and Planetary Change, having authored 18 papers that have together received 445 indexed citations. Recurring topics across this work include Climate Change Policy and Economics (10 papers), Energy, Environment, and Transportation Policies (10 papers), Global Energy and Sustainability Research (8 papers), Atmospheric and Environmental Gas Dynamics (4 papers), Market Dynamics and Volatility (4 papers), Economic and Environmental Valuation (3 papers), Monetary Policy and Economic Impact (2 papers) and Fiscal Policy and Economic Growth (2 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(216 citations), Economics and Econometrics (327 citations), General Energy (7 citations), General Economics, Econometrics and Finance (53 citations) and Global and Planetary Change (88 citations). Brian Prest has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include Richard G. Newell, Steven Sexton, William A. Pizer, Lisa Rennels, David Anthoff, Frank Errickson, Hana Ševčíková, Cora Kingdon, Roger Cooke and Kevin Rennert. Their work appears in journals such as Journal of the Association of Environmental and Resource Economists, Energy Economics, The Energy Journal, Science and Brookings Papers on Economic Activity.
